Analysis of the impacts of land-use change on streamflow is crucial for the sustainable development of water resources and land-use management practices. Specifically, the understanding of the urbanization impacts on streamflow will significantly help water resources and land-use managers and planners in decision-making processes. Therefore, this study was designed to analyze the potential impacts of future land-use change, specifically of urbanization on the streamflow of the Chipola River using the Soil and Water Assessment Tool (SWAT) in ArcGIS for four years (2015-2018).
